Where history was made

Henry Middleton a wealthy Boulder Creek resident determined that the water main that fed his house could also create enough electricity to light his store, his house, the public hall and the livery stable as well as a light hanging over the Main Street in front of his store. This was demonstrated every night for a week to the people of Boulder Creek and it was the first electricity to be used in Boulder Creek.
